WebMay 8, 2016 · Allocate memory to tabB statically using a 2D array as char tabB [SIZE1] [SIZE2] = { {0}}; or dynamically as for (i = 0; i < SIZE; ++i) tabB [i] = malloc (...); or using … WebA deep copy is a copy that creates a new object with new memory locations for all of its properties and nested objects or arrays. It means that if you make changes to the copied object or any of its nested objects or arrays, it will not affect the original object. Here is an example of deep copying an object using the JSON.parse() and JSON ...
Array : How do I do a deep copy of a 2d array in Java? - YouTube
Web2 days ago · Shallow copying only creates a new reference to the existing objects or values and doesn’t create a deep copy, which means that nested objects are still referenced, not duplicated. Let’s look ... WebMaybe just something to think about, but 2 and higher dimensional arrays are generally a PITA because of things like this. You may want to consider using a standard 1D array … joy seafood palace
how to copy all elements of a 2d array to another 2d array?
WebTo ensure all elements within an object array are copied, use copy.deepcopy: >>> import copy >>> a = np.array( [1, 'm', [2, 3, 4]], dtype=object) >>> c = copy.deepcopy(a) >>> c[2] [0] = 10 >>> c array ( [1, 'm', list ( [10, 3, 4])], dtype=object) >>> a array ( [1, 'm', list ( [2, 3, 4])], dtype=object) previous numpy.ascontiguousarray next WebJun 23, 2024 · When you copy an object in JavaScript, you can either create a deep copy or a shallow copy. The benefit of a deep copy is that it copies nested objects, so you … WebArray in Java is index-based, the first element of the array is stored at the 0th index, 2nd element is stored on 1st index and so on. Unlike C/C++, we can get the length of the array using the length member. In C/C++, we need to use the sizeof operator. In Java, array is an object of a dynamically generated class. joy sectionals